Senior Accountant

About the Team

 

General Ledger Accounting Services team is responsible for supporting European, Asian, and American entities of Swiss Re Group according to internal guidelines, US GAAP, IFRS and local accounting policies and tax requirements. As a member of the team, you support legal entity and branch accounting and closing activities. You seek possibilities to further develop, streamline and improve the team's delivery processes and collaboration with our partners.

 

Main customers: Group Finance, Tax teams, Internal & External Audit

 

About the role

 

  • Provide timely and accurate non-technical accounting services according to internal guidelines, regulatory and Group requirements

  • Perform quarterly closing activities of defined entities

  • Support financial controlling of selected entities with focus on group requirements (payable/receivable sign- offs, reconciliations for the accounts under our ownership, and related tasks)

  • Provide accurate financial information to the management to enable timely and current decisions to be made

  • Financial reporting to local tax teams

  • Ensure compliance with the risk and control framework and the audit requirements

  • Support audit activities and prepare requested information

  • Participate and support Finance related projects and perform ad hoc tasks as required

  • Identify and evaluate process improvement possibilities

  • Any other ad hoc tasks as required

 

About You 

 

  • You have three to five years of work experience in accounting/financial reporting

  • You are qualified in Accounting, Audit, Finance and/or university degree in Economics, Science or Business Administration

  • Knowledge of accounting and regulatory frameworks

  • Understanding of financial risk and control processes

  • Experience in the use of standard bookkeeping software for financial accounting

  • SAP experience is an advantage

  • Proven PC skills,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int

  • Great teammate with good communication skills

  • You are engaged and motivated

  • Fluent written and spoken English

About Swiss Re

 

Swiss Re is one of the world’s leading providers of reinsurance, insurance and other forms of insurance-based risk transfer, working to make the world more resilient. We anticipate and manage a wide variety of risks, from natural catastrophes and climate change to cybercrime. Combining experience with creative thinking and cutting-edge expertise, we create new opportunities and solutions for our clients. This is possible thanks to the collaboration of more than 14,000 employees across the world.
